The Pinellas County Construction Licensing Board investigates reports of unlicensed contractors.
Did you know, if you are a Florida licensed contractor that works in Pinellas County you must also be licensed with Pinellas County? This is a seperate license, with an additional application required.
Did you know that a homeowner can receive a citation or fine for hiring an unlicensed contractor to do work on their home?
Always make sure you check both the Florida and the Pinellas County sites below to ensure your contractor is properly licensed for the job before you hire them.
